<p>If you&#8217;ve been tasked with cleaning toilets with a tiled floor in a pub, club or restaurant and they&#8217;re in pretty bad shape, follow our advice below;<a href="http://www.sourcesupplies.co.uk/blog/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Deck-Scrubber.jpg"><img class="alignright size-thumbnail wp-image-351" title="Blue High Low Deck Scrub Brush" src="http://www.sourcesupplies.co.uk/blog/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Deck-Scrubber-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a></p>
<p><strong>Equipment<br />
</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Deck Scrubber</li>
<li>Wet Vac</li>
<li>Mop &amp; bucket</li>
</ul>
<p><strong><a href="http://www.sourcesupplies.co.uk/blog/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Scrubbing-Grout.jpg"><img class="alignleft size-thumbnail wp-image-350" title="Scrubbing Grout" src="http://www.sourcesupplies.co.uk/blog/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Scrubbing-Grout-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a>Urine</strong> – The idea is to bring up the layers and layers of uric acid that have built up over the weeks/months/years (!) and have settled into the grout.</p>
<p><strong>No Quick Fix &#8211; </strong>These layers will continue to come to the surface with repeat cleaning over a few months but it&#8217;s not a job that produces instant results so it&#8217;s worth explaining this to your client.  A wet vac is essential in order to stop the uric acid settling back into the tile and grout.</p>
<ol>
<li>Use a heavy duty hard surface cleaner with a water soluble solvent – Selden F40 ‘Strongarm’</li>
<li>Dolute 1:10 with warm water (40-50 degrees)<a href="http://www.sourcesupplies.co.uk/blog/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Selden-Strongarm.jpg"><img class="alignright size-thumbnail wp-image-343" title="Selden Strongarm" src="http://www.sourcesupplies.co.uk/blog/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Selden-Strongarm-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a></li>
<li>Thoroughly scrub with a deck scrubber</li>
<li>Leave for 5 minutes</li>
<li>Repeat scrubbing</li>
<li><strong>Thoroughly</strong> rinse off with water</li>
<li>Pick up <strong>all</strong> the water with a wet vac</li>
<li>Repeat entire process once or twice more</li>
<li>Daily use multi-purpose cleaner for daily cleaning with wet vac if possible</li>
</ol>
<p><a href="http://www.sourcesupplies.co.uk/blog/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Scrubbing-Brush-for-Machine.jpg"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-355" title="Scrubbing Brush for Machine" src="http://www.sourcesupplies.co.uk/blog/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Scrubbing-Brush-for-Machine-300x155.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="155" /></a>The deck scrubber is best used in areas that have cubicles or are tight spaces. If you have a large open space then using a low speed rotary floor scrubbing machine would produce great results with a brush attachment.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We are currently working with 3 customers (2 large schools and 1 leisure centre) on finding the best cleaning machines for their requirements.</p>
<p>Each have  different needs so I thought it would be useful to make our advice available to all.</p>
<p>Things we need to consider are;</p>
<ul>
<li>Type of floor &#8211; Altro safety flooring, ceramic tiles (wet and dry side), gymnasium etc and the type of brush or pad required</li>
<li>Location of use and storage &#8211; Is there a lift available? How mobile does it need to be? What size space does it need to fit into and be stored in?</li>
<li>Power options &#8211; Battery or mains?</li>
<li>Size of area being cleaned &#8211; What size tanks does it need?</li>
<li>Budget &#8211; Entry level machine or one with all the bells and whistles?</li>
<li>Operators &#8211; Who will be using it? What training is required?</li>
</ul>
<p>Cleaning machines can be a fantastic way to achieve better results and save money. The initial outlay is a big commitment, yes, but the benefits far outweigh alternative manual cleaning methods in most circumstances. Give us a call if you&#8217;d like to chat through your requirements.</p>
